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ows are an investment that will improve the energy efficiency of your home. They can lower your energy costs by slowing down the transfer of heat from your home to other buildings. This will make your home more comfortable in the winter months and cooler in summer, meaning you don't have repairs to upvc windows rely as much on heating and air conditioning systems. You'll reduce your electric and gas bills.

A double-glazed window comprises two glass panes which are separated by an air gap and upvc door repair near Me then filled with an insulating gas, such as Krypton or Argon. This type of insulation makes them more efficient than single pane windows. The type of glass you use in double-glazed windows can also impact its energy efficiency. There are many kinds of low-emissivity glass that have different levels of visible light transmission (VLT). The VLT is measured with an angle of 0deg. It also reflects infrared long-wave heat away from the sun. The lower the VLT the lower the solar heat gain your windows have.

The U value of double-glazed windows which is a measure of the ease with which the window conducts warmth is another aspect that determines their thermal performance. The lower the U value is, the better the insulation properties of the window. Double-glazed windows with a lower U value are more effective in keeping heat inside during the colder months and out during the warmer seasons.

Security

Double glazing is more resistant to breaking than single panes and is able to stand up to the force of a brick being thrown at it. The insulating gap between the panes makes it difficult for thieves to break into your home through the windows. The gaps are narrow enough that you still get lots of light.

Double-glazed windows can help reduce condensation in older homes. Condensation occurs when the warm air inside a house meets the cold glass of a window. This causes dampness that can give furniture and carpets an unpleasant smell and promote mildew spores to grow. Double glazing ensures that the warm air can never meet with the cold glass, so condensation doesn't happen.

Although there are restrictions on the type of double glazing you can install for older homes, such as those with listed buildings, you can improve the efficiency of your home by installing secondary double glazing. This is a glass pane that can be put in place over windows that are already in place and does not require permission for planning. Noise reduction

If you're looking for a quiet home that is comfortable and free of the noise from neighbors or outside traffic, double glazing could assist. A typical window with just one pane of glass can let in a lot of noise however a double-glazed unit, called an IGU includes two layers of glass and an air gap that reduces the sound transmission. This permits an STC rating of between 28 and 32. This makes a double-glazed windows in my area the best option for homes that are located in noisy areas.
